Advent is a spiritual journey that Christians take, through themes that point to the birth of Jesus as Messiah Advent – a time of preparation 1 The Promise of God 2 The Prophets 3 John the Baptist (preparer) 4 Mary, his mother According to Luke

1 Many have undertaken to draw up an account of the things that have been fulfilled among us, 2 just as they were handed down to us by those who from the first were eyewitnesses and servants of the word. 3 With this in mind, since I myself have carefully investigated everything from the beginning, I too decided to write an orderly account for you, most excellent Theophilus, 4 so that you may know the certainty of the things you have been taught.
4
Luke… …is aware of previous writings about Jesus (uses Mark) …investigated the story for himself …has written ‘an orderly account’ (shaped for readers)
5
Mary’s Baby will be… …a boy called Jesus (God’s salvation – ‘Joshua’) …a king from the line of David …Son of the Most High/God …born of the Holy Spirit
6
Mary’s Baby will challenge… …Roman political structures Roman Empire V David’s Kingdom …Roman Imperial authority Caesar Augustus ‘Son of God’ V Jesus ‘Son of God’
7
Mary’s Baby will … … fulfil the hopes for a Jewish Messiah …be a new Joshua (God saves) …a new David (God’s King) A child of two worlds
